In the Infant Room

Held, known, and gently encouraged

From their very first days with us, our youngest tamariki are welcomed into a calm, unhurried space. Our infant room moves at the pace of each child — room to crawl, reach, rest, and wonder, with caregivers who notice the small moments that matter.

We work closely with whānau to keep each baby's rhythm consistent between home and centre — from feeds and sleeps to the songs and words they're learning to love.

  • Primary caregiver relationships for secure attachment
  • Sensory-rich floor time and movement exploration
  • Gentle routines shaped around each baby's rhythm
  • Daily communication with parents on feeds, sleeps, and milestones
A Day in the Infant Room

A gentle daily rhythm

Each baby's day flows to their own pattern, with sleeps and feeds guided by the child rather than the clock. This is the shape of a typical day in our infant room.

7:30 am
Combined arrival & settling in
9:00 am
Morning kai
9:30 am
Free-flow exploration
11:00 am
Lunch
Throughout the day
Sleep follows each child's rhythm
2:00 pm
Afternoon kai
2:30 pm
Quiet activities
4:00 pm
Combined after-care
5:30 pm
Centre closes
